[0042] According to an exemplary embodiment of the present invention, the highly crystalline ethylene-propylene copolymer (a-2) has a high crystallinity of more than about 45% by weight, thereby having an effect of increasing rigidity of molded articles. In this case, when the degree of crystallinity is less than about 45% by weight, rigidity decreases. Preferably, the degree of crystallinity is from about 55 to 100 wt. 87, 89, 90, 91, 93, 95, 97, 99 or 100% by weight).
[0043] Exemplary highly crystalline ethylene-propylene copolymers (a-2) have a melt index of about 10 to about 30 g / 10 min (2.16 kg at 230°C). In this case, when the melt index is less than about 10g / 10min (at 230°C, 2.16kg), the moldability is reduced due to the decrease in fluidity, and when the melt index is greater than about 30g / 10min (at 230°C, , 2.16kg), Izod and surface impact strength decrease. Embodiment 1
[0079] A polypropylene polymer was prepared consisting of a mixture of 15% by weight of an ethylene-propylene copolymer having an ethylene content of 50% by weight and 85% by weight of a highly crystalline ethylene-propylene copolymer, the high The crystalline ethylene-propylene copolymer has a crystallinity of 55% by weight.
[0080] Next, a polyethylene resin composition composed of a mixture of 70% by weight of a low specific gravity polyethylene polymer having a specific gravity of 0.91 and 30% by weight of an ethylene vinyl acetate copolymer in which each Long chain branches of 1000 carbons are 5% by weight, and the ethylene vinyl acetate copolymer has 30% by weight of vinyl acetate.

Embodiment 2
[0083] With the same content used in Example 1 to prepare the composition of polypropylene composite resin, the polyethylene resin composition of the mixture of 70% by weight of low specific gravity polyethylene polymer and 30% by weight of ethylene vinyl acetate copolymer will be used Processed in the form of pellets, the low specific gravity polyethylene polymer has a specific gravity of 0.906 and has 7% by weight of long chain branches per 1000 carbons, the ethylene vinyl acetate copolymer has 40% by weight of vinyl acetate ester. The pellets were injected under injection conditions of 220±30°C to prepare test specimens for evaluation of thermal / mechanical properties.
